1 前言

初学Proteus,画好原理图后遇到了power rails ‘GND’ and 'VCC/VDD' are interconnected in net VCC的报错。
尝试了网上的解决办法,都没能解决我的问题。
最后自己搞了半天,还是解决了这个错误,因此记录并且分享一下我解决的办法,目前在网上还没看到有人提到这种办法。
这个错误报了两次,用了不同的办法分别解决了。

2 分析

简单说一下我解决这个报错的思路:
这个错误直译过来就是 GND和VCC连在了一起(短路了)。
首先检查了原理图有没有GND和VCC连在一起的情况,但是我的图中没有,这就很为难我这个初学菜鸡了。所以我猜测除了原理图中显示的用wire的连接,各终端可能还有隐藏的别的连接方式。

3 解决

参考方法1:检查隐藏引脚

  1. 显示隐藏引脚
    Template -> Set Design Colours -> 勾选show hidden pins
    隐藏引脚默认是灰色

  2. 检查有没有隐藏引脚连接在一起的情况,有则删去中间的连线。
    例如,我的原理图中,因为元件摆放的距离过近,导致两个元件的隐藏引脚直接连在了一起,如下图,灰色的是隐藏引脚。

    拖开了上面的元件,并删去了连线后,报错少了一条。

参考方法2:检查 Power Rail Configuration

  • 打开Power Rail Configuration:Design -> Power Rail Configuration
    在Name处,选中VCC/VDD 查看有没有右边的框中有没有GND,如下图。
    若有,选中GND后,点击Remove。
    若弹出对话框提示无法删去,他们之间是通过wire实体连接的,大概还是要在图中找bug了。

下图是我删除后的,删除之前的没有截图,就不再伪造一次错误了。

4 小结

第一次接触Proteus,感觉这种坑对于初学者还是蛮难找的,太坑了。
PS:如果有错,请批判指正哈。

Proteus报错处理经验:power rails ‘GND’ and 'VCC/VDD' are interconnected in net VCC的更多相关文章

  1. linux下报错处理经验

    这是训练中文vocab做的句子相似度的程序: /home/xbwang/torch/install/bin/luajit: /home/xbwang/newtextsimilarity/util/Vo ...

  2. webStrom中React语法提示,React语法报错处理

    1,webStrom中React语法报错 ①, 取消Power Save Mode的勾选 File——Power Save Mode ②,webstorm开发react-native智能提示 随便在一 ...

  3. 关于mac安装rails报错clang: error: unknown argument

    文章都是从我的个人博客上转载过来的,大家可以点击我的个人博客. www.iwangzheng.com mac上安装rails的时候报错, 安装rails的在终端执行了一句命令: $sudo gem i ...

  4. (办公)json报错的解决问题的小经验.

    经验:一半,一半的查,看那一段报错,当确定这一步的时候,用最笨的方法,用眼去看,出哪里的错误. 看有没有替换特殊字符的方法,去整理.

  5. centos7 做rails 执行rails server 报错

    做操作rails   server 时  报错 这个错误时因为一些东西没有安装 gem install execjsgem install therubyracersudo apt-get insta ...

  6. go Rails 知识点,Concepts Series:url和parameter; 建立Rails App Templates;报错页面debug; counter_cache

    Rails Concepts Series: https://gorails.com/series/rails-concepts 基本都是免费的 一些细小的知识点,很有帮助. URL和paramete ...

  7. rails执行sidekiq任务的时候报错“can't connect to local mysql server through socket '/var/run/mysqld/mysqld.sock'”

    rails执行sidekiq任务的时候报错“can't connect to local mysql server through socket '/var/run/mysqld/mysqld.soc ...

  8. 解决脱离rails使用activerecord报错 NameError: uninitialized constant ActiveRecord::Migrator::Zlib

    上下文说明 原本系统是15.10,无奈只支持1年,所以今天升级16.04,环境答好后运行rake migratte报错 task :default => :migrate desc 'Run m ...

  9. CentOS5.6下安装Oracle10G软件 【保留报错经验】

    CentOS5.6下安装Oracle10G ****************************************************************************** ...

随机推荐

  1. PAT Basic 1010 一元多项式求导 (25 分)(活用stringstream,昨天学习的)

    设计函数求一元多项式的导数.(注:x​n​​(n为整数)的一阶导数为nx​n−1​​.) 输入格式: 以指数递降方式输入多项式非零项系数和指数(绝对值均为不超过 1000 的整数).数字间以空格分隔. ...

  2. eclipse多个项目提交到同一个仓库(码云)

    参考博客:Eclipse提交多个项目到同一个仓库 https://blog.csdn.net/qq_30764991/article/details/80379365 步骤一:码云建立个远程仓库 步骤 ...

  3. python3-使用__slots__

    正常情况下,当我们定义了一个class,创建了一个class的实例后,我们可以给该实例绑定任何属性和方法,这就是动态语言的灵活性.先定义class: class Student(object): pa ...

  4. Jmeter性能测试请求超时:目前遇见有三种情况

    1.请求连接超时.连不上服务器.一般是因为线程太多 2.连接成功,但是读取超时.等不到服务器返回的数据,一般是这次请求查询的量很大,比如查了5度的顶点.(timeout小于server的最大等待时间) ...

  5. Azure IoT 技术研究系列3

    上篇博文中我们将模拟设备注册到Azure IoT Hub中:我们得到了设备的唯一标识. Azure IoT 技术研究系列2-设备注册到Azure IoT Hub 本文中我们继续深入研究,设备到云.云到 ...

  6. unittest----skip(跳过用例)

    我们在执行测试用例时,有时有些用例时不需要执行的,这时就需要用到unittest给我们提供的跳过用例的方法 @unittest.skip(reason):强制跳过,不需要判断条件.reason是跳过原 ...

  7. Gparted for partition of Linux on graphic interface

    You can change the partition table on Linux by a group of tools, which is tool comprehansive for a n ...

  8. 安装VS2017

    www.visualstudio.com/zh-hans/downloads/ https://visualstudio.microsoft.com/zh-hans/thank-you-downloa ...

  9. Dijkstra算法求最短路模板

    Dijkstra算法适合求不包含负权路的最短路径,通过点增广.在稠密图中使用优化过的版本速度非常可观.本篇不介绍算法原理.只给出模板,这里给出三种模板,其中最实用的是加上了堆优化的版本 算法原理 or ...

  10. ipcloud上传裁切图片

    主页: <!doctype html> <html> <head> <meta charset="utf-8"> <meta ...